1. Tomahawk Steak from Chops Grille
If you’re a steak lover, the Tomahawk steak at Chops Grille is an absolute must-try. This premium cut of meat, available for an additional charge, is renowned among cruisers for its size and quality. Recently, during my trip on the Icon of the Seas, fellow passengers raved about this dish, urging me to sample it myself. The result? A juicy, flavorful experience that is truly the ultimate steak for any meat aficionado.
2. Wonderland's Chocolate Globe
For those seeking a whimsical dining experience, Wonderland is a specialty restaurant inspired by the enchanting tales of Alice in Wonderland. One of the standout items on their menu is the Chocolate Globe dessert. This visually stunning dish features a chocolate globe that, when warm chocolate is poured over it, melts into a gooey, rich indulgence. Not only is it a feast for the palate, but it’s also a feast for the eyes.
3. French Onion Soup from the Main Dining Room
Good food doesn’t always come with an extra price tag, and the French Onion Soup served in the Main Dining Room is a testament to that. I’ve sampled French Onion Soup at numerous establishments, but Royal Caribbean's rendition stands out for its exceptional flavor. Served piping hot, it features a perfect blend of onions, broth, and bread topped with a generous layer of melted cheese. You can also find this classic dish available every night in Coastal Kitchen.
4. Crepes at Aquadome Marketplace
The Aquadome Marketplace offers a vibrant culinary scene, but the Crepes station deserves special recognition. The consistently long lines are a testament to the popularity of these freshly made delicacies. Whether you prefer sweet or savory, the crepes can be customized to your liking, making them the perfect snack or meal option.
5. Brisket from Portside BBQ
Portside BBQ may not be available on every Royal Caribbean ship, but it’s worth seeking out when it is. This hidden gem serves up some of the best smoked brisket I’ve tasted. Tender and flavorful, the brisket practically melts in your mouth, making it a must-have for barbecue lovers.
6. Ranger Cookie from Café Promenade
When it comes to snacks, the Ranger Cookie from Café Promenade is a crowd favorite. This delightful treat is chewy and satisfying, hitting all the right notes without being overly sweet. Polling fellow cruisers often reveals that the Ranger Cookie is a go-to choice for a quick snack or dessert.
